MUTTON KHEEMA PATTIES GRAVY!! I made this Patties gravy few days back for lunch along with Mutton Briyani.As I want the Patties to be flour free and grain free , I made it with eggs and ground masala.
The Patties was so yummy and also very filling .I had it as Patties and my family had it as gravy along with Briyani.
The simple and easy recipe is as below,
RECIPE SOURCE : Archana's kitchen.
INGREDIENTS :
FOR GRAVY :
Onions – 1 no.
Ginger garlic paste – 1/2 tsp.
Chilli powder – 1 tsp.
Turmeric powder – 1/4 tsp.
Garam masala – 1/2 tsp.
Corinader powder – 1/2 tsp.
Pepper powder – 1/4 tsp.
Tomatoes – 3 nos ( medium sized).
Salt – as required.
Coriander leaves and mint leaves – few for garnishing.
Cumin – 1/2 tsp.
Coconut oil or refined oil – 1 tsp.

FOR PATTIES :
Minced mutton – 1/2 kg.
Chilli powder – 1 tsp.
Garam masala – 1/2 tsp.
Salt – as required.
Egg – 1 no.
Coconut oil or refined oil – 4 tsp.

TO GRIND :
Mint leaves – handful.
Almond or cashews – 3 nos.
Ginger – 1/2” piece – 1 no.
Garlic – 5 pods.
Green chillies – 3 nos.

METHOD :
  1. Grind mint leaves , almonds , ginger, garlic , green chillies to fine paste.
  2. Wash and clean minced meat and add above ground paste , salt , chilli powder , garam masala , egg and mix well.
  3. Heat tawa and spread few drops of oil , make small pattice from mutton mixture and place it on hot tawa .
  4. Keep the flame in low ,drizzle few drops if oil and close the pan.cook for 5 mins.
  5. Then turn the Patties to next side and cook for 10 more mins.
  6. Like wise turn each side for every 5 mins and cook closed.
  7. When Patties boiled crisp and turns brown on both sides remove from flame and keep it aside.
  8. Same way fry all Patties and keep them aside.
  9. The Patties itself tastes great that you can eat as it is , but also you can make it into gravy and enjoy.
FOR GRAVY :
  1. Heat oil in kadai and add cumin , followed by onions and saute till onions turns brown.
  2. Now ginger garlic paste , chilli powder , coriander powder , garam masala powder , turmeric powder and fry till ginger garlic fries well.
  3. Add chopped tomatoes and saute till mushy.
  4. Add 1/4 cup water , salt , coriander leaves , mint leaves and boil for a minute.
  5. When gravy reached required consistency gently add fried mutton Patties and mix slowly so that the masala covers the Patties .
  6. Remove from flame and serve immediately.
  7. I served with mutton briyani.The gravy goes well with fried rice too.

NOTE :
  1. You can serve the Patties alone without gravy too.
  2. Instead of adding chopped tomatoes , you can grind the tomatoes and add too.
